In her statement, Crystal Dunn describes a personal experience where she was part of various teams but stood out as the only black girl among predominantly white or differently composed groups. This observation highlights a sense of isolation and the unique position she held within those environments.
Beyond its literal interpretation, this quote delves into broader themes such as identity, diversity, and inclusion in sports. Dunn’s experience reflects common challenges faced by individuals from minority backgrounds who often find themselves isolated due to racial or cultural differences. Her statement invites readers to consider the importance of creating inclusive spaces where everyone feels represented and valued. It also underscores the need for more diverse teams that reflect the broader community, fostering a sense of belonging for all participants.
Crystal Dunn is an accomplished American soccer player known for her skill on the field and her contributions both as a professional athlete and advocate for inclusivity in sports. Her career has spanned international competitions and she continues to inspire through her experiences and public speaking engagements.
